NIKE ONE Vapor Golf Balls:
# 3-piece seamless Ionomer blend -designed for the skilled game
# Multi-layer construction, and softened compression to improve performance and lower scores
# Delivers the perfect balance of distance and control
# Progressive density core maximizes distance for average swing speeds
# Power Transfer Layer maximizes velocity distance and control throughout the bag
# Softened Ionomer blend outer cover
# 336 seamless dimple design adds length, control and consistency

Model Reviewed: One Vapor

Like every golfer I'm trying to find the "perfect" ball for my game. The Vapor is a nice compromise but it is exactly that. Very good off the driver and great feel with the putter, it tends to lack on greenside control and fares average off the irons. Long and mid iron behavior is similar to most mid-range 3 pc balls but approach/wedge shots need compensation for a little roll. Chip shots check but still roll out. I guess you give up some performance for a little more durability. Negatives aside, the performance with the putter and driver is a real plus and the feel is just what I'm looking for. I primarily use these in warm weather but switch to the Wilson Staff Zip in colder weather. I'm happy with this ball but would like a little more greenside control engineered in its design.

Model Reviewed: Nike One Vapor

First round with Nike One Vapor. I have been an avid V1 user for the past 5 years and have sacrificed distance for the wonderful greenside capabilities of the V1. Made a swing change earlier this year to approach the ball on a steeper angle and found that my spin rate with the driver has increased significantly. So I decided to go to a 3 layer ball. The steady ball flight and consistent distance is terrific. My biggest concern was around the greens. Well, all of that worry went away with the purchase of 2 brand new wedges. Great Ball Nike !!!

Model Reviewed: vapor one

I had high expectations for the Nike Vapor and so far it hasn't lived up to it. The best attribute is its feel off the putter-- similar to premium balls. Driver distance is good enough, and durability is above average. The downside is its lack of greenside manners. Almost feels like a muted rock ball off the wedges. I mainly play mid range balls (Hot Bite, Burner TP, E+) and my scores are higher with the Vapor balls. I will save the remaining Vapors for summer, maybe they'll play better in warmer weather. So far they are not up to the hype, and I consistently shoot lower scores with the Hot Bites and Burner Tps.

Model Reviewed: Nike One Vapor

Not being a big Nike fan I am reluctant to buy into any of their hype. The only product they ever built I thought was good was the original sasquatch with the next ti face. That being said,this ball is great! Long, soft and a fair amount of spin. Did I say long how about real long. Putts well, and spin seems to be on par with titleist nxt tour, but aprox. 10 yards longer off the driver. My S.S. is 98 to 103 mph for reference. Ball flight is good and I haven't experienced any ballooning off the irons or driver. They should be about$4.00 cheaper but Nike is good at gouging for their inferior stuff so when they come up with something good expect to pay what they ask.
